LONGWOOD, FL-With the topic of abortion commanding so much attention in news headlines today, Xulon Press author D.J. Parsons felt led to write a book addressing it. In Ascribing Responsibility to Abortion and Other Atrocities--An Indictment to Men and The Thief on the Cross Got to Go--A Survival Guide for All of Us Who Have Done Something Terrible ($11.99, paperback, 978-1-60791-512-6; $19.99, hardcover, 978-1-60791-513-3), the author hopes to communicate themes of forgiveness and survival to her readers. The first part of her book begins by introducing readers to the idea that both pro-life and pro-choice are misnomers that have created thirty years of going nowhere. The second part of the book aims to instill in readers the idea that it's high time they re-examine their belief system. When combined, the book makes for an exhilarating, eye-opening read that is sure to resonate with readers of all stripes.

Says Parsons, "I want to stir the pot. I want to strike a nerve. Labels such as democrat, republican, liberal, and conservative must be put aside. Those who hold to the 'We're right, I didn't do it, I don't need to cover my shame' [belief] will be separated out. The book's purpose is not to explain the big picture, but to encourage taking the first step: asking for forgiveness."

A retired fashion designer, Parsons says it wasn't until she became a church secretary that she became aware there is very little behavior difference between the churched and unchurched. After researching, reading, and analyzing more than 50 books on Christianity and the Bible, she compiled her findings into a book she knew would benefit everyone. "I want to share what I have learned with those who do not have the time and luxury to do this study," she says.
